A leading vehicle conversion company are seeking a skilled welder to join a team known across the UK for engineering excellence in bespoke vehicle assembly. As a part of the team you'll bring technical expertise, attention to detail, and pride in your work to ensure every product meets high quality standards.
Responsibilities:- Welding components made from alloy, mild steel, and stainless steel.
- The welds will form part of visible vehicle structures, requiring an exceptional eye for detail to achieve a clean, professional finish that reflects our reputation for quality and innovation.
- Welding mild and stainless steel and alloys using MIG and TIG processes.
- Measuring, cutting, and finishing welded works to the highest standards.
- Using hand tools such as grinders, saws, and other workshop equipment.
